Heeft er iemand nog ervaring met andere bots?
Forumregels
Sinds 1 januari 2009 wordt phpBB2 niet meer ondersteund.
Onderstaande informatie is verouderd en dient uitsluitend als archief.
Sinds 1 januari 2009 wordt phpBB2 niet meer ondersteund.
Onderstaande informatie is verouderd en dient uitsluitend als archief.

Dit is het adres van de afbeelding:
/profile.php?mode=confirm&id=217c795145a4f0a7439b5bc40bc82899
Bedoel je dat er uit de id te herleiden valt welke letters er verschijnen? Ik weet niet precies hoe de VC van phpBB werkt, maar dat geloof ik dus niet.. De slimmigheid is nou juist dat die informatie niet uit de broncode te halen valt.
/profile.php?mode=confirm&id=217c795145a4f0a7439b5bc40bc82899
Bedoel je dat er uit de id te herleiden valt welke letters er verschijnen? Ik weet niet precies hoe de VC van phpBB werkt, maar dat geloof ik dus niet.. De slimmigheid is nou juist dat die informatie niet uit de broncode te halen valt.
- Bas
- Berichten: 2741
- Lid geworden op: 02 dec 2003, 17:38
- Locatie: Omgeving Goslar (Duitsland)
- Contacteer:
Dit topic zal wat zijn voor BasPre Default Banlist 

.Bas Hosting, gratis hosting met FTP, PHP en MySQL | viennaCMS, simpel flexibel open source CMS
Hoe ban je tegenwoordig? 'Deny' bij alle rechten!
Hoe ban je tegenwoordig? 'Deny' bij alle rechten!
Het is een mooi idee, maar dan moet ik wel iemand hebben die dat kan maken, en ook mensen die willen meewerken informatie te verzamelen. Door een beetje met google te kijken kom je wel namen tegen, maar geen IP's.Muiter schreef:Is het niet mogelijk één centrale database te maken waar deze informatie word gechekd en/of binnengehaald door elk forum?
... Maar ik modereer (nog) niet.
Deze MOD al bekeken, Bee?
http://www.phpbb.com/phpBB/viewtopic.ph ... ht=spambot
http://www.phpbb.com/phpBB/viewtopic.ph ... ht=spambot
Code: Selecteer alles
MOD Name: disable spambots
Author: magenta
MOD Description: This mod uses cryptographic signing techniques to ensure that any comment submissions have occurred from an appropriate
comment form (stopping simple random-submission bots), that
the form was actually generated for the user who is submitting (stopping clusters of page-scraping spiders), and that at least 5 seconds have passed between the form generation and the submission (stopping bots which fully scrape the page and then immediately submit). If one of these conditions is not met, the submit operation is turned into a preview, giving human posters another chance to submit.
Since implementing this mod, my forum has only gotten two spams posted to it, and both were manually posted by a human. Countless thousands of spams were blocked.
For added security, you should change the "nana" and "foofoo" text inserted in the first "BEFORE, ADD" step so that spambots can't simply spoof the form values as well.
Als hier een goed script voor word geschreven wil ik mijn sever waar ook modelautoforum.nl op draait en een aparte database beschikbaar stellen.Spambot schreef:Hihi wist ik wel, maar wie heeft er verder een betrouwbare server die altijd online is en dit de komende jaren wil hosten?
Hoi! Ik ben een onderschrift virus, kopieer/plak mij in jouw onderschrift om mij te verspreiden!
- Bas
- Berichten: 2741
- Lid geworden op: 02 dec 2003, 17:38
- Locatie: Omgeving Goslar (Duitsland)
- Contacteer:
Ik heb al een systeem gemaakt, momenteel is het een .BasAPIClass, maar je kunt hem gewoon maken, en dan ->run() doen, dan gaat hij vanzelf.
(Maar eerst moet $page gedefd zijn, met de huidige pagina, en een &, en dat script is om in de BasSetup de Volgende-knop weer te geven.)
Dit script is al ingebouwd in de installatie van BasPre!
(Maar eerst moet $page gedefd zijn, met de huidige pagina, en een &, en dat script is om in de BasSetup de Volgende-knop weer te geven.)
Code: Selecteer alles
<?php
class botban {
function run() {
global $page, $db;
$prefs = (isset($_GET['prefs'])) ? $_GET['prefs'] : 1;
if ($prefs == 1) {
?>
<a href="<?php echo $page.'prefs=2&yes' ?>">Yes, I want to ban known bots!</a><br />
<a href="<?php echo $page.'prefs=2' ?>">No, I don't want to ban known bots!</a><br />
<?php
}
if ($prefs == 2) {
if (isset($_GET['yes'])) {
$ip_list = file('http://www.paulscripts.nl/bots/bots.txt');
foreach($ip_list as $ip) {
$sql = "INSERT INTO " . BANLIST_TABLE . " (ban_ip)
VALUES ('" . $ip . "')";
if ( !$db->sql_query($sql) )
{
echo('Could not ban '.$ip.'...');
}
}
echo "Banned them!";
}
?>
<script type="text/javascript">parent.document.getElementById('submitbut').style.display='inline';</script>
<?php
}
}
}
?>
Laatst gewijzigd door Bas op 13 aug 2005, 16:27, 1 keer totaal gewijzigd.
.Bas Hosting, gratis hosting met FTP, PHP en MySQL | viennaCMS, simpel flexibel open source CMS
Hoe ban je tegenwoordig? 'Deny' bij alle rechten!
Hoe ban je tegenwoordig? 'Deny' bij alle rechten!
Hier heb je wel iets aan, wanneer wij een redelijk lijst met bots hebben.
EDIT:
OP http://www.paulscripts.nl/bots/ vind je een lijst met bots, en kan je bots toevoegen (Hun IP dan) aan de lijst. Basts script maakt van deze lijst gebruik!
EDIT:
OP http://www.paulscripts.nl/bots/ vind je een lijst met bots, en kan je bots toevoegen (Hun IP dan) aan de lijst. Basts script maakt van deze lijst gebruik!